Occidental Murcia Agalia is a contemporary hotel situated in the vibrant city of Murcia, Spain, known for its rich history and cultural attractions. The hotel is strategically located near the city center, providing easy access to popular tourist sites, shopping districts, and local dining establishments. With its modern design and welcoming ambiance, Occidental Murcia Agalia aims to meet the needs of both leisure and business travelers.
The hotel features a stylish and functional interior, with comfortable furnishings and minimalist decor that create a relaxing environment. Each guest room is well-equipped with essential amenities, including complimentary Wi-Fi, air conditioning, and a flat-screen TV, ensuring a comfortable stay for guests. The hotel's commitment to providing excellent service is evident in the attention to detail and the friendly, professional staff always ready to assist visitors.
Dining at Occidental Murcia Agalia is a pleasant experience, with options that showcase both local and international cuisine. Guests can enjoy a diverse breakfast buffet and later dine at the on-site restaurant, which offers a variety of dishes crafted with quality ingredients.
For those looking to relax and unwind, the hotel provides leisure facilities, including an outdoor swimming pool and a well-equipped fitness center. Business travelers can take advantage of the meeting rooms and event spaces, which are designed to accommodate a range of professional gatherings.
Overall, Occidental Murcia Agalia offers a modern, convenient base for exploring Murcia, with an emphasis on quality service and guest satisfaction.
Murcia, located in southeastern Spain, offers a variety of activities and attractions that showcase its rich history and culture. One of the highlights of the city is the Cathedral of Murcia, an impressive example of Baroque architecture. Visitors can explore its beautiful interior and admire the stunning bell tower, which provides panoramic views of the city.
Another significant site is the Casino de Murcia, a beautifully restored building that reflects the social life of the 19th century. Inside, you can find elegant rooms adorned with exquisite decorations that tell the story of its historical importance. The Plaza de las Flores is also a charming spot where you can enjoy the atmosphere, surrounded by cafes and flower stalls, making it a perfect place to relax.
For those interested in museums, the Museo Salzillo showcases the works of the renowned sculptor Francisco Salzillo, known for his religious sculptures. The Museo de Bellas Artes features a collection of paintings and sculptures spanning several centuries, providing insight into the region's artistic heritage.
Outdoor enthusiasts can explore the Sierra Espuña Natural Park, where hiking trails offer scenic views and opportunities to connect with nature. The nearby Murcia Segura River is a great spot for leisurely walks along its banks.
Culinary experiences in Murcia are noteworthy, particularly the traditional dishes that highlight the region's agricultural bounty. Sampling local specialties, such as zarangollo and pastel de carne, provides a taste of the area's flavors.
Visiting the local markets, such as the Mercado de Verónicas, allows travelers to experience daily life and discover fresh produce, meats, and artisan goods. Engaging with the community through these markets can enhance your understanding of Murcian culture.
Overall, Murcia offers a blend of historical, cultural, and natural attractions that cater to various interests, making it a worthwhile destination for those looking to explore southern Spain.
